Ancient World, Roman Empire, Constantine II (337-361 AD), Bronze Follis, 1.89 gms, 16.42 mm, Siscia Mint, Obv: Diademed bust of emperor to right, Latin legend around ‘CONSTANTINVS IVN NOB C‘, Rev: Two soldiers standing symmetrically opposite to each other with twin standards in between, Latin legend around ‘GLORIA EXERCITVS’, ‘SIS’ in exurge, RIC VII # 109, very fine to extremely fine, rare in this grade.
